/ (Деление) (Transact-SQL)
Выполняет деление одного числа на другое (арифметический оператор деления).
Синтаксические обозначения в Transact-SQL
Синтаксис
dividend / divisor
Аргументы
dividend
Делимое числовое выражение. dividend может быть любым допустимым выражением любого типа данных из категории числовых данных, за исключением типов данных datetime и smalldatetime.divisor
Числовое выражение, на которое делится делимое. divisor может быть любым допустимым выражением любого типа данных из категории числовых данных, за исключением типов данных datetime и smalldatetime.
Типы результата
Возвращает тип данных аргумента с более высоким приоритетом. Дополнительные сведения см. в разделе Приоритет типов данных (Transact-SQL).
Если целочисленный аргумент dividend делится на целочисленный аргумент divisor, то результатом будет целое число, а дробная часть будет усечена.
Замечания
Фактическое значение, возвращаемое оператором /, представляет собой частное от деления первого выражения на второе.
Примеры
В следующем примере арифметический оператор деления используется для вычисления целевого объема продаж за месяц для персонала по продажам из Компания Adventure Works Cycles.
USE AdventureWorks2012;
GO
SELECT s.BusinessEntityID AS SalesPersonID, FirstName, LastName, SalesQuota, SalesQuota/12 AS 'Sales Target Per Month'
FROM Sales.SalesPerson AS s
JOIN HumanResources.Employee AS e
ON s.BusinessEntityID = e.BusinessEntityID
JOIN Person.Person AS p
ON e.BusinessEntityID = p.BusinessEntityID;
См. также
Справочник
Встроенные функции (Transact-SQL)
Предложение WHERE (Transact-SQL)